Details
- Title: 地獄少女
- Title (romaji): Jigoku Shoujo
- Also known as: Hell Girl
- Format: Renzoku
- Genre: Drama, Horror
- Episodes: 12
- Broadcast network: NTV
- Broadcast period: 2006-Nov-4 to
- Air time: Saturday 25:20 to 25:50
- Theme song: Dream Catcher by OLIVIA
Synopsis
Somewhere in the vast sea of the Internet, there's a website that can only be accessed at the stroke of midnight. Known as the Jigoku Tsushin, rumor has it that if you post a grudge there, the Jigoku Shoujo will appear and drag whoever torments you into the inferno. Very little is known about the girl - all we know for sure is that she lives with her equally enigmatic grandmother, that three magical straw dolls accompany and serve her, and that whenever a posting on the Jigoku Tsushin moves her, she becomes the Jigoku Shoujo.
Cast
- Iwata Sayuri as Enma Ai
- Sugimoto Aya as Hone Onna
- Kato Kazuki as Ichimoku Ren
- Ogura Hisahiro as Wanyuudou
- Irie Saaya (入江紗綾) as Tsugumi Shibata
- Nishimura Kazuhiko as Hajime Shibata
- Odaka Anna (ep1)
- Asaoka Megumi (麻丘めぐみ) (ep1)
- Konno Narumi (ep1)
- Ochiai Motoki (落合扶樹) (ep2)
- Matsuzawa Kazuyuki (松澤一之) (ep2)
